Navigating BMS Cybersecurity Threats: A Practical Guide

Protecting Building Management Systems (BMS) from escalating cyber attacks demands a comprehensive approach. This overview outlines practical steps for securing your BMS infrastructure. Firstly, establish robust network division, limiting access and containing the propagation of any intrusion. Regularly update firmware and software, addressing weaknesses before they can be leveraged . Consider multi-factor authorization for remote access. Additionally, undertake periodic security reviews and penetration testing to detect potential risks . Finally, employee awareness is critical ; ensuring staff understand possible phishing scams and safe data handling .

Cyber Security in Building Automation : Essential Approaches for Building Managers

As contemporary automation platforms become increasingly reliant on digital technologies, maintaining cyber safety is vital for facility administrators . A vulnerable BMS can lead to significant threats, including information leaks , system malfunctions , and monetary losses . To mitigate these likely problems , implementing robust digital protection measures is necessary . Here's a look at some key best approaches:

  • Frequently upgrade BMS programs to address known vulnerabilities .
  • Implement strong passwords and layered authentication for all staff.
  • Separate the BMS infrastructure from external networks to restrict unauthorized access .
  • Conduct routine vulnerability assessments to detect and correct possible shortcomings .
  • Inform building employees on digital security recommended guidelines .
  • Observe BMS activity for unusual behavior .

Basically, proactive online safety preparation is vital for preserving the integrity and safety of a advanced property .

Digital Safety for BMS: A Practical Checklist

Ensuring the security of your Building Management System (BMS) is essential in today's networked world. This approach provides a practical method for evaluating your current digital posture .

  • Enforce robust authentication policies, including periodic changes and multi-factor authentication .
  • Audit your network architecture for vulnerabilities and potential entry points.
  • Keep your BMS firmware and associated utilities with the latest patches .
  • Divide your BMS network from other organizational networks to limit the reach of a attack.
  • Conduct regular risk assessments and simulated testing.
  • Train your personnel on cybersecurity best methods .
Following this plan will help strengthen your BMS's cyber resilience and lessen the threat of a disruptive incident.
